The Chairman of public sector banks are selected by the

  1. A. Banks Board Bureau
  2. B. Reserve Bank of India
  3. C. Union Ministry of Finance
  4. D. Management of concerned bank

Answer: A

Explanation

Banks Board Bureau recommends for selection of heads – Public Sector Banks and Financial Institutions and helps banks in developing strategies and capital raising plans. Banks Board Bureau is an Autonomous Body of the Government of India. It is committed to improving the governance and boards of public sector financial institutions. The Secretariat of the Bureau currently comprises Secretary and four officers. Hence option (a) is the correct answer.
